Shrimp Mappas

Once in a while I really crave for the traditional plate with the thick red kerala rice and fish curry . As I had some shrimp in my fridge so decided to make shrimp kappas , this recipe has different variations but coconut milk is a must in this dish . Add some dal fry and veggies fry and you got a complete thali Yummy 

What you need :

Deveined Prawns -  20-30
Red onions - 1 finely chopped
Ginger - 1/2 inch chopped
Garlic - 5-6 crushed
Green chilies- 4-5 slit long
Curry leaves- 5-6
EVOO- 1 tablespoon
Mustard seeds - 1 teaspoon
Kodum puli -1-2 soaked in water
Coconut milk - 1/2 cup
Turmeric pwd- 1 teaspoon
Chilly pwd - 1 teaspoon
Garam masala - 1 teaspoon
Smoked paprika - 2 teaspoon ( this gives a very authentic taste to fish curry )
Salt to taste
Coconut oil optional to garnish
  • Heat a thick bottom pan with oil add the mustard seeds let them splutter add onions saute for a few mins till soft then ginger , garlic , green chilies cook for few more mins
  • Add all the dry ingredients turmeric , paprika, chilly pwd,  salt cook till the raw smell goes away then add the Puli let this simmer for a good 5-10 mins 
  • Add the coconut milk make sure the flame is low , then gently add  the cleaned shrimp cook for few mins as shrimp very fast .
  • Last step add the garam masala and curry leaves for authentic taste try a teaspoon of coconut oil and enjoy with red yummy rice ;)

Peppermint barks


As we all leave 2017 behind and move ahead into 2018 , let's hope for kindness and compassion for each other . So on that note I decided to start with a dessert bringing in the much needed sweetness for this year :)
This is a very easy recipe the only tricky part is melting the chocolate , using a double boiler is a reliable method just make sure that the chocolate is constantly stirred usually takes a few minutes ,

What u need  :
White cooking chocolate - 12 oz 
Dark cooking chocolate - 12 oz 
Peppermint sticks - crushed 
  1. Line a 9x12 pan with parchment paper.Melt the dark chocolate (use the method you prefer, either double boiler, or microwave - cook 30 seconds in a heat-proof bowl, stir and repeat until you have a smooth consistency.
  2. Pour the melted dark chocolate on the parchment paper, spread the chocolate out until it is about 1/3" thick. You can do this by hitting the pan on the counter top repeatedly, or maybe you could use a spatula to spread the chocolate.
  3. Melt the white chocolate, using the steps above. After the chocolate is smooth, pour it on top of the dark chocolate - trying to make the layers the same thickness.
  4. Unwrap the peppermints of your choice and put them into a zip lock bag, crush the mints then, while the white chocolate is still melted sprinkle on top. 

  5. Let the chocolates harden in the refrigerator for 2 hours, then break the candy into pieces. Njoy !
